Quote At CES 2022, Dell announced their latest high-end gaming monitor. The Alienware 34 QD OLED offers a 175Hz QHD panel, 1800R curvature, and Nvidia G-Sync support, among other features. When the debut date, which is set for late March 2022, is confirmed, the pricing will be revealed. The Alienware 34 QD OLED gaming monitor from Dell is another ace up its sleeve (model number AW3423DW). It’s the “world’s first Quantum Dot OLED” gaming display with exceptional specs. We currently have no idea how much it will cost. Dell said it will release the price closer to the shipping date, which is slated for March 2 in China, March 29 in North America, and April 5 in Europe (rest of the world).
